In a speech entitled, … shelter insurance addressWebFrom March 22, 1942, Sir Stafford Cripps, carried out negotiations with the Congress seeking support from Indians for Britain in World War II. The Congress sought immediate and complete transfer of power. The negotiations, which came to an end on April 11, 1942, failed as the British did not agree to the demand.
